The Dominguez Family
December 2005
Project Summary:
A 2 day project for a family that escaped extreme abuse. Mom had secured a job and apartment, but left with nothing just to be safe for her family. The family did not have beds, they slept on the floor. They did not have proper winter clothing and utilized some broken used furniture to furnish their home.
Walls of Hope provided a Canadian Xmas – Winter clothes, gifts under a tree (including a tree) Fully furnished apt including: beds, bus passes, grocery cards, glasses, Sport enrolment, and resume skills to secure income for them family.
This special family has succeeded with better jobs; the children have excelled in school and with honours’. The family has since volunteered with Walls of Hope many times; paying it forward
A true success story
